Blu-ray (not Blue-ray) also called Blu-ray Disc (BD), is the name associated with a next-generation optical disc format jointly developed from the Blu-ray Disc Association (BDA), a team of the world’s primary consumer electronics, PC and media manufacturers (including Apple, Dell, Hitachi, HP, JVC, LG, Mitsubishi, Panasonic, Pioneer, Philips, Samsung, Sharp, Sony, TDK and Thomson).
The format was developed to allow recording, rewriting and playback of high-definition video (HD), as wel as keeping large amounts of information. This data format offers over five times the storage capability associated with traditional DVDs and will hold as much as 25GB on a single-layer disc and 50GB on a dual-layer disc. This added capacity combined with the use of state-of-the-art video and audio codecs will offer consumers an unprecedented HD experience.
Whilst existing optical disc technologies such as DVD, DVDR, DVDRW, and DVD-RAM make use of a red laser to read and write data, the new format employs a blue-violet laser instead, consequently the name Blu-ray. Despite the distinctive type of lasers applied, A Blu ray disc player can conveniently be made backwards compatible with CDs and DVDs through the use of a BD/DVD/CD compatible optical pickup unit. The benefit of using a blue-violet laser (405nm) is that it has a shorter wavelength when compared with a red laser (650nm), which makes it possible to concentrate the laser spot with even greater accuracy. This allows data to be packed alot more tightly and stored in less space, so it is possible to fit more data on the disc despite the fact that it’s the same size as a CD/DVD.
This together with the change of numerical aperture to .85 is what enables Blu ray Dvds to hold 25GB/50GB. Recent development by Pioneer has pushed the storage capacity to 500GB on a single disc by employing 20 layers.
Blu-ray is currently supported by about 2 hundred of the world’s major consumer electronics, personal pc, recording media, game and also music companies. The format has the benefit of support from all Hollywood studios and many smaller studios as a successor to today’s DVD format. Lots of studios have additionally proclaimed that they will begin releasing new feature films on Blu ray Dvds as well as a continuous slate of catalog titles every month. .
